Replacement Ignition Wires
If you're Mercedes ignition key replacement requires the installation of a new set of spark plug wires make sure that you're using right ones for your vehicle. They are vital for transferring high voltage energy from your ignition coil to the sparkplugs. The sparkplugs ignite the fuel-air mixture and ignites your car's engine.
Before you replace the spark plug wires, you must make sure they are the correct length for your vehicle. Different brands of spark plug wires can have different lengths. It is crucial to make sure that the wires are compatible and not mix them up.
Make sure your new spark plug wires are properly installed will help prevent your car from malfunctioning or slowing down. It will also save you money in the long run.
To begin, put the spark plug's end of the wire with the boot on top of the spark plug's insulator and push it into. This will allow the end to snap into position without damaging the connection. Once it's properly secured you'll be able to test the connection by pulling the boot back off the wire and checking whether it can be removed easily.
After you've removed the old wires, make sure to clean the spark plug insulator and distributor cap towers prior to installing the new ones. Any debris left behind can cause arcing, or sag in your wires.
When securing the wires to the cap of the distributor or the spark plugs, use a self-locking cable tie instead of the screwdriver. This will prevent them rattling around during repairs, and ensure they stay in place until you are ready to put them back together.
